Here's the breakdown of some prominent roles related to the Professional Certificate in Simulation for Connected Materials: - **Simulation Engineer**: These professionals design and implement mathematical models and simulations to analyze, predict, and visualize the behavior of connected materials. They typically work in industries like manufacturing, automotive, and aerospace. - **Data Scientist**: Data scientists leverage statistical methods and machine learning techniques to analyze large datasets from simulations and connected materials. They help create data-driven strategies and decision-making processes. - **Materials Scientist**: Materials scientists study the properties, composition, and structure of materials, including connected materials. They conduct experiments, simulations, and analyses to develop new materials and improve existing ones. - **Software Developer**: Software developers build and maintain software applications to facilitate simulations and connected materials analysis. They work closely with other professionals to design user-friendly interfaces and integrate various tools and systems. These roles are essential in the UK's job market, with increasing demand for professionals who possess expertise in simulation for connected materials.
